Once the dust of the Revolution settled, the problem of reconciling the erstwhile warring factions arose, and as is often the case the matter made its way into the legal arena. Rutgers v. Waddington was such a case. Through this little-known but remarkable dispute, Peter Charles Hoffer recounts a tale of political and constitutional intrigue.
